These two disorders combine to produce a variety of symptoms including: * Confusion * Changes to vision * Loss of muscle coordination * Difficulty swallowing * Speech problems * Hallucinations * Loss of memory * Confabulation (occurs as the individual makes up stories to compensate for their memory loss) * Inability to form new memories * Inability to make sense when talking * Apathy The final six symptoms on the list are due to Korsakoff psychosis.
